Are you using evict_outdated_slaves?

<parameter name="evict_outdated_slaves" unique="0" required="0">
<longdesc lang="en">
If set to true, any slave which is more than max_slave_lag seconds
behind the master has its MySQL instance shut down. If this parameter
is set to false in a primitive or clone resource, it is simply
ignored. If set to false in a master/slave resource, then exceeding
the maximum slave lag will merely push down the master preference so
the lagging slave is never promoted to the new master.
</longdesc>
<shortdesc lang="en">Determines whether to shut down badly lagging
slaves</shortdesc>
<content type="boolean" default="${OCF_RESKEY_evict_outdated_slaves_default}" />
</parameter>
